Hotel Description

Guesthouse Kinosaki Wakayo, located at 737 Kinosakicho Yushima, Toyooka, Hyogo 669-6101, Japan, is a charming accommodation nestled in the heart of Kinosaki Onsen, a renowned hot spring resort town. The property offers a serene and welcoming environment where guests can enjoy a peaceful retreat surrounded by traditional Japanese architecture and the relaxing atmosphere of the onsen town. The guesthouse is a perfect base for travelers looking to explore the local culture, with several famous hot springs just a short walk away. Its proximity to Yanagiyu and Ichinoyu Onsen makes it an ideal choice for those looking to experience authentic Japanese hot spring baths.

Transportation is convenient, with Kinosakionsen Station just a 10-minute walk away. The property is also accessible by taxi from nearby transportation hubs such as Tajima Airfield and Gembudo Station, making it easy to travel to and from the guesthouse.
Nearby attractions include Kinosaki Onsen, Goshonoyu Onsen, and Satono Yu Onsen, all within walking distance. Additionally, guests can visit Jizo-yu Onsen, a short stroll from the guesthouse. I had a wonderful and comfortable stay in a private room here. This guesthouse has a cosy atmosphere and is a good value. The location is very convenient for visiting the hot springs around town. They will loan you a yukata, geta (sandals), and bag for visiting the hot springs. You can buy a one-day pass inexpensively (1500 yen as of 2023) at any of the 7 baths and go to as many as you like.The owner I met was very friendly and welcoming.
